    Try adjusting the UAC settings to a lower level, which should give you more control over which apps are allowed to make changes to your computer. To do this, go to Control Panel > User Accounts > Change User Account Control settings. Move the slider down to a lower level and click OK.

    If you still have issues run the app as administrator.
